Transaction 890fee790ab10b6d05ef1be5e682f41aac561198d926db88d5e7cc3029abc7ec
2 Input
1 Outputs
- 890fee790ab10b6d05ef1be5e682f41aac561198d926db88d5e7cc3029abc7ec:0
value 121107
address 329UpX2jifh7JdSoNVoHNvybTVVfEkCQKy